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
 
Рейтинг: Рейтинг темы: голосов - 10, средняя оценка - 4.70
dzrkot
zzzZZZ...
523 / 353 / 54
Регистрация: 11.09.2013
Сообщений: 2,025
#1

Книга Стива Макконнелла "Совершенный код. Мастер-класс" - C++

15.09.2014, 13:23. Просмотров 1760. Ответов 17
Метки нет (Все метки)

Совершенный код. Мастер-класс
Автор: Стив Макконнелл

Есть те читал сию книгу с форума?Стоит ли брать? Читал положительные отзывы но всё же будет интересно мнение бывалых форумчан...
1
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
15.09.2014, 13:23
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Книга Стива Макконнелла "Совершенный код. Мастер-класс" (C++):

Создать класс "Книга" с полями "название книги", "количество страниц", "год издания" - C++
Создать класс Книга поля: название книги,количество страниц,год издания методы: вычислить сколько лет книге и количество дней прошедших...

Создать абстрактный класс "Издание" и производные классы "Книга", "Статья", "Электронный ресурс" - C++
1. Создать абстрактный класс Издание с методами, позволяющими вывести на экран информацию об издании, а также определить является ли данное...

Реализовать связь классов "телефонная книга" и родительский класс "телефонный номер" - C++
Суть проблемы:есть дочерний класс "телефонная книга" и родительский класс "телефонный номер". В классе "телефонная книга" к заданной...

Структура "Книга", класс "Библиотека" - C++
Компилируется без ошибок, при попытке выполнить программу выползает ошибка: Error: Error: Unresolved external 'bibl::in(bibl*,int&)'...

Класс "Складская книга", содержащая названия товара, цену и количество на складе - C++
Написать программу, обеспечивающую простейшие манипуляции с классом, определяющим: запись в скадской книге, содержащую названия товара,...

Класс "Книга". Как убрать каракули? - C++
Разработать классы для описанных ниже объектов. Включить методы set (...), get (...), show (...). Определить другие методы. Book:...

17
Tulosba
:)
Эксперт С++
4397 / 3233 / 297
Регистрация: 19.02.2013
Сообщений: 9,045
15.09.2014, 14:31 #2
Книга хорошая. Имеет смысл брать.
2
DrOffset
7376 / 4453 / 1009
Регистрация: 30.01.2014
Сообщений: 7,304
15.09.2014, 18:00 #3
dzrkot, стоит. хотя перевод подхрамывает местами (не сильно), но если есть возможность, то лучше читать в оригинале.
2
Croessmah
Ушел
Эксперт CЭксперт С++
13553 / 7704 / 872
Регистрация: 27.09.2012
Сообщений: 19,006
Записей в блоге: 3
Завершенные тесты: 1
15.09.2014, 18:04 #4
Бери не думай!
2
0x10
2479 / 1652 / 248
Регистрация: 24.11.2012
Сообщений: 4,095
15.09.2014, 18:16 #5
В противовес восторженным отзывам.
Сам я за эту книгу принимался три раза.
Сначала - на первом курсе. Всю не осилил, а из осиленного не понял ровным счетом ничего. Как и не понял откуда у нее столько положительных отзывов.
Второй раз - уже на третьем курсе. Тогда казалось, что это самая-лучшая-книга-в-мире, где есть ответы на все вопросы. Но полностью не прочитал, т.к. разрывался между учебой и работой.
Третий раз - уже после всех защит, с несколькими годами работы за плечами. Прочитал полностью и... не нашел ровным счетом ничего нового для себя. Были интересные мысли, но в общем и целом - какое-то капитанство.

А вывод будет банальным: всему свое время. На определенном периоде становления специалиста книга может оказаться полезной. Когда уже есть некоторая техническая база, но мало представления о процессе разработки крупных коммерческих продуктов.
4
DrOffset
15.09.2014, 18:24
  #6

Не по теме:

Цитата Сообщение от 0x10 Посмотреть сообщение
А вывод будет банальным: всему свое время. На определенном периоде становления специалиста книга может оказаться полезной. Когда уже есть некоторая техническая база, но мало представления о процессе разработки крупных коммерческих продуктов.
С этим согласен. Тоже самое можно сказать про книгу по паттернам. Откровений каких-то человек, который работал несколько лет и не филонил (не раскладывал пасьянсы вместо работы) возможно и не найдет. Но книга сама по себе хорошая.

0
dzrkot
zzzZZZ...
523 / 353 / 54
Регистрация: 11.09.2013
Сообщений: 2,025
15.09.2014, 18:32  [ТС] #7
ну поскольку орпыта у меня менее года за плечами, да и разрабатываю я на микроконтроллеры, но хочу переключиться в др область то пожалуй всё же возьму) всем спасибо)
0
gru74ik
Модератор
Эксперт CЭксперт С++
4196 / 1844 / 198
Регистрация: 20.02.2013
Сообщений: 4,991
Записей в блоге: 22
19.12.2015, 15:30 #8
Цитата Сообщение от dzrkot Посмотреть сообщение
Совершенный код. Мастер-класс
Автор: Стив Макконнелл
Получил эту книгу месяц назад от супруги в подарок на днюху. Прочитал уже примерно половину (читаю 15 главу). Читается легко, но чего-то нового для себя обнаруживаю мало - просто систематизация уже полученных ранее знаний. В общем, "Repetitio est mater studiorum".
0
Tulosba
19.12.2015, 15:40
  #9

Не по теме:

gru74ik, аватарка на форуме правдивая оказалась

0
gru74ik
19.12.2015, 15:41
  #10

Не по теме:

Цитата Сообщение от Tulosba Посмотреть сообщение
gru74ik, аватарка на форуме правдивая оказалась
ага

0
ct0r
19.12.2015, 16:06
  #11

Не по теме:

gru74ik, а давай вместе книжки читать, а то мне одному скучно уже

0
gru74ik
Модератор
Эксперт CЭксперт С++
4196 / 1844 / 198
Регистрация: 20.02.2013
Сообщений: 4,991
Записей в блоге: 22
19.12.2015, 16:23 #12
Цитата Сообщение от ct0r Посмотреть сообщение
gru74ik, а давай вместе книжки читать, а то мне одному скучно уже
Давай У меня после Макконнелла на очереди банда четырёх. Жаль, что в мягком переплёте, ну да ладно (может возьму, да сам переплету - будет у меня эксклюзивное handmade издание ).

Добавлено через 11 минут
Про книжку Макконнелла ещё хотелось бы сказать вот что. Кто будет покупать, не думайте, что это новое издание. Да, на книжке написано "2016 год", но на деле это перевыпуск (доп. тираж) того же самого второго издания 2004 года. И некоторые моменты там, увы, неизбежно устарели.
0
ct0r
Игогошка!
1776 / 678 / 42
Регистрация: 19.08.2012
Сообщений: 1,294
Завершенные тесты: 1
19.12.2015, 16:50 #13
Цитата Сообщение от gru74ik Посмотреть сообщение
У меня после Макконнелла на очереди банда четырёх.
Она же ж уже устарела Почти все паттерны в современном С++ реализуются иначе. Не говоря о том, что сейчас паттерны - скорее средство коммуникации, нежели руководство к действию. Но раньше они были блестящими, модными, и понтовыми, это верно
Вообще я наверное в скором времени оформлю пост, в котором опишу книги, прочитанные мной за этот год, и перечислю книги, которые стоят в очереди на следующий. Систематизация - это полезно.
1
Dimension
Dimension
569 / 438 / 135
Регистрация: 08.04.2014
Сообщений: 1,709
Завершенные тесты: 1
19.12.2015, 16:51 #14
нафига вообще покупать книжку если это все в интернете есть
0
gru74ik
Модератор
Эксперт CЭксперт С++
4196 / 1844 / 198
Регистрация: 20.02.2013
Сообщений: 4,991
Записей в блоге: 22
19.12.2015, 17:18 #15
Цитата Сообщение от Dimension Посмотреть сообщение
нафига вообще покупать книжку если это все в интернете есть
Я люблю на диване после работы полежать с бумажной книжкой.
0
19.12.2015, 17:18
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
19.12.2015, 17:18
Привет! Вот еще темы с ответами:

Создать класс "Вентилятор" содержащий в себе классы: "Двигатель", "Контроллер", "Пульт управления" - C++
Помогите с кодом написания задачи, не понимаю как написать классы в классе. Нужно создать класс "вентилятор" содержащий в себе классы:...

Написал класс "Телефонная книга". Но при работе вылетает ошибка. помогите разобраться. - C++
Доброго времени суток! Пацаны, дайте подсказку. Пишу телефонную книгу с классами и у меня возникла проблемка (чтение из файла по полям...

Описать базовый класс "книга" - C++
Помогите пожалуйста описать базовый класс "книга". Написать поиск по автору и году выпуска

Класс "Телефонная книга" - C++
что тут не правильно помогите пожалуйста спасибо class DATE { unsigned int day; unsigned int month;


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
15
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ru